This helped me to get a good, early start on one of the commissioned single quilts. After some debating, I settled on waterwheel and star blocks. Twenty 9", 9-patch blocks each.
I decided to speed piece and paper piece the patches. The 3" half-square triangles- 80 of them - took me about two hours to do, including printing out the templates for speed piecing and rotary cutting the fabrics (I cut an extra half inch around which helped in pinning it to the template). The 80 3" strip-pieced blocks took another 2 hours, including pressing them out.
